WebNov 30, 2024 · 2,000 square feet X 40 BTUs = 80,000 BTU output required Thanks to the equation, we know we need 80,000 BTUs of heat. But before we buy an 80,000 BTU furnace, there’s furnace efficiency to consider as well. For instance, a furnace with 80,000 BTU input and an 80% efficiency rating will only produce 64,000 BTUs. We need something stronger.
